Getting There by Air
The national airline is Cayman Airways (KX) (website: www.caymanairways.com).
Approximate Flight Times
From London to Grand Cayman is 10 hours and from Miami to Grand Cayman is 1 hour.
Main Airports
Grand Cayman (GCM) (Owen Roberts International Airport) is 2km (1 mile) east of the city. To/from the airport: Taxis are available to the centre (journey time – 10 minutes), operating from 0600 to 2300, for a fare of about US$10. There is also an airport bus available that must be pre-booked. Facilities: Outgoing duty-free shop, banks/bureaux de change, ATM, post office, car hire, bars, restaurants, cafes, VIP lounge, and tourist information.
Cayman Brac (CYB) (Gerard Smith Airport) is 8km (5 miles) from the town. To/from the airport: Taxis meet all flights (journey time – 10 minutes). Facilities: Duty-free shop, restaurant and car hire.

Getting There by Water
Main ports: Grand Cayman is one of the most popular Caribbean ports and a busy port of call for leading international cruise lines operating from North America, Mexico and Europe.
